directions

  • In a large saucepan cook the cubed sweet potatoes or yams in boiling water until very tender. Drain.
  • Put the sweet potatoes into a large mixing bowl and beat with an electric beater until smooth.
  • Add the eggs, 1/4 cup brown sugar, 1/4 cup melted butter, salt and cinnamon and beat until everything is well blended.
  • Add 1/4 cup of the orange juice and beat again. If the mixture is not moist and fluffy, add up to 1/4 cup more orange juice.
  • Lightly butter a souffle or casserole dish and add the beaten sweet potato mixture.
  • Arrange the pecan halves on top.
  • Sprinkle the 1/2 cup brown sugar and the remaining 1/4 cup melted butter on top.
  • Bake 375 degrees for about 30 minutes or until hot.
